我想使用jquery为特定的div应用height,但不能使用'!important'覆盖jquery关键字。

这是标记:

<div id="divL1" class="myclass">sometext here</div>
<div id="divL2" class="myclass">sometext here</div>
<div id="divL3" class="myclass">sometext here</div>
<div id="divL4" class="myclass">sometext here</div>

CSS:
.myclass{
 height:50px !important;
}

在这里,我想找到divid等于“divL3”的class“myclass”

我尝试过:
$('#divL3.myclass').css('height', '0px');

但不会工作!因此,如何覆盖'!important' css using jquery

帮助赞赏!

最佳答案

尝试这个 :

$( '.myclass' ).each(function () {
    this.style.setProperty( 'height', '0px', 'important' );
});

.setProperty()使您可以传递表示优先级的第三个参数。

09-03 17:48
查看更多